Measuring Disease Activity in Psoriatic Arthritis
Table 3
Minimal disease activity (MDA) criteria in psoriatic arthritis.
| A patient is classified as in MDA when 5 of the following 7 criteria are met: | |
| Tender joint count ≤1 | | Swollen joint count ≤1 | | PASI ≤1 or BSA ≤3 | | Patient pain VAS ≤15 | | Patient global activity VAS ≤20 | | HAQ ≤0.5 | | Tender enthesial points ≤1 | |
|
|
PASI: Psoriasis Area and Severity Index; BSA: Body Surface Area; VAS: Visual Analog Scale; HAQ: Health Assessment Questionnaire.
